Transaction 31bbeb9015d6140350a37a3951079fd9ad4117fd0942c9f62e3964d777d79ab0
1 Input
1 Output
-
31bbeb9015d6140350a37a3951079fd9ad4117fd0942c9f62e3964d777d79ab0:0
- value
- 998030
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e13681f25e22d830ddce4236129878ef63df77bc OP_EQUAL
- address
- 3NDqFxet4uwSdUinwYZSxMMHa77tv6P54P